Three Mile Island Reactor Could Power Microsoft Data Center

Officials announced plans to bring back online one of the nuclear reactors at Three Mile Island, the site of a historic partial meltdown 45 years ago. Constellation Energy, in partnership with Microsoft, aims to restart the plant to provide power to a new artificial intelligence data center. This move marks a significant milestone in the clean energy sector.

Reviving Three Mile Island Unit 1

The Crane Clean Energy Center project will reactivate Three Mile Island Unit 1, which ceased operations due to economic challenges in competing with natural gas energy production in Pennsylvania. The plant’s safety track record and reliable performance make it a suitable candidate to resume operations independently from Unit 2, the site of the 1979 meltdown.

Tech Giants Turn to Nuclear Energy

Tech companies, including Microsoft, are increasingly turning to nuclear power to meet the high electricity demands of data centers. Nuclear energy offers a cost-effective, carbon-free solution for powering AI applications. This innovative approach, known as co-location, enables data centers to connect directly to nuclear plants, ensuring a reliable and sustainable energy supply for tech operations.

Economic and Environmental Impact

The restart of Three Mile Island is expected to create thousands of jobs and generate significant tax revenue for Pennsylvania. Despite concerns about the 1979 accident, recent studies indicate widespread support for reviving the nuclear plant. State and federal regulatory approvals are required to proceed with the project, aligning with efforts to diversify the nation’s energy portfolio.
